@@ -21,8 +21,8 @@ discard block  | 
                                                    ||
| 21 | 21 | */  | 
                                                        
| 22 | 22 | public function indexByJob(JobPoster $jobPoster)  | 
                                                        
| 23 | 23 |      { | 
                                                        
| 24 | -          $comments = Comment::where('job_poster_id', $jobPoster->id)->get(); | 
                                                        |
| 25 | - return response()->json(new ResourceCollection($comments));  | 
                                                        |
| 24 | +            $comments = Comment::where('job_poster_id', $jobPoster->id)->get(); | 
                                                        |
| 25 | + return response()->json(new ResourceCollection($comments));  | 
                                                        |
| 26 | 26 | }  | 
                                                        
| 27 | 27 | |
| 28 | 28 | /**  | 
                                                        
@@ -34,12 +34,12 @@ discard block  | 
                                                    ||
| 34 | 34 | */  | 
                                                        
| 35 | 35 | public function store(StoreComment $request, JobPoster $jobPoster)  | 
                                                        
| 36 | 36 |      { | 
                                                        
| 37 | - $data = $request->validated();  | 
                                                        |
| 38 | - $comment = new Comment();  | 
                                                        |
| 39 | - $comment->user_id = $request->user()->id;  | 
                                                        |
| 40 | - $comment->job_poster_id = $jobPoster->id;  | 
                                                        |
| 41 | - $comment->fill($data);  | 
                                                        |
| 42 | - $comment->save();  | 
                                                        |
| 43 | - return response()->json(new JsonResource($comment));  | 
                                                        |
| 37 | + $data = $request->validated();  | 
                                                        |
| 38 | + $comment = new Comment();  | 
                                                        |
| 39 | + $comment->user_id = $request->user()->id;  | 
                                                        |
| 40 | + $comment->job_poster_id = $jobPoster->id;  | 
                                                        |
| 41 | + $comment->fill($data);  | 
                                                        |
| 42 | + $comment->save();  | 
                                                        |
| 43 | + return response()->json(new JsonResource($comment));  | 
                                                        |
| 44 | 44 | }  | 
                                                        
| 45 | 45 | }  | 
                                                        
@@ -81,8 +81,7 @@ discard block  | 
                                                    ||
| 81 | 81 | 'orderable' => false,  | 
                                                        
| 82 | 82 |              'function' => function ($entry) { | 
                                                        
| 83 | 83 | return $entry->isOpen() ?  | 
                                                        
| 84 | - '<span><i class="fa fa-check-circle"></i></span>' :  | 
                                                        |
| 85 | - '<span><i class="fa fa-circle"></i></span>';  | 
                                                        |
| 84 | + '<span><i class="fa fa-check-circle"></i></span>' : '<span><i class="fa fa-circle"></i></span>';  | 
                                                        |
| 86 | 85 | }  | 
                                                        
| 87 | 86 | ]);  | 
                                                        
| 88 | 87 | $this->crud->addColumn([  | 
                                                        
@@ -92,8 +91,7 @@ discard block  | 
                                                    ||
| 92 | 91 | 'orderable' => false,  | 
                                                        
| 93 | 92 |              'function' => function ($entry) { | 
                                                        
| 94 | 93 | return $entry->isClosed() ?  | 
                                                        
| 95 | - '<span><i class="fa fa-check-circle"></i></span>' :  | 
                                                        |
| 96 | - '<span><i class="fa fa-circle"></i></span>';  | 
                                                        |
| 94 | + '<span><i class="fa fa-check-circle"></i></span>' : '<span><i class="fa fa-circle"></i></span>';  | 
                                                        |
| 97 | 95 | }  | 
                                                        
| 98 | 96 | ]);  | 
                                                        
| 99 | 97 | |
@@ -124,8 +122,7 @@ discard block  | 
                                                    ||
| 124 | 122 | 'function' =>  | 
                                                        
| 125 | 123 |              function ($entry) { | 
                                                        
| 126 | 124 | return $entry->submitted_applications_count() > 0 ?  | 
                                                        
| 127 | -                    '<a target="_blank" href="' . route('manager.jobs.applications', $entry->id) . '">' . $entry->submitted_applications_count() . ' (View <i class="fa fa-external-link"></i>)</a>' : | 
                                                        |
| 128 | - $entry->submitted_applications_count();  | 
                                                        |
| 125 | +                    '<a target="_blank" href="' . route('manager.jobs.applications', $entry->id) . '">' . $entry->submitted_applications_count() . ' (View <i class="fa fa-external-link"></i>)</a>' : $entry->submitted_applications_count(); | 
                                                        |
| 129 | 126 | }  | 
                                                        
| 130 | 127 | ]);  | 
                                                        
| 131 | 128 | |
@@ -40,7 +40,7 @@ discard block  | 
                                                    ||
| 40 | 40 | 'limit' => 120,  | 
                                                        
| 41 | 41 | ]);  | 
                                                        
| 42 | 42 | |
| 43 | - $this->crud->addField([ // Select  | 
                                                        |
| 43 | + $this->crud->addField([// Select  | 
                                                        |
| 44 | 44 | 'label' => 'Owner User Role',  | 
                                                        
| 45 | 45 | 'type' => 'select',  | 
                                                        
| 46 | 46 | 'name' => 'owner_user_role_id', // the db column for the foreign key  | 
                                                        
@@ -50,7 +50,7 @@ discard block  | 
                                                    ||
| 50 | 50 | 'attributes' => ['disabled' => 'disabled']  | 
                                                        
| 51 | 51 | ]);  | 
                                                        
| 52 | 52 | |
| 53 | - $this->crud->addField([ // Select  | 
                                                        |
| 53 | + $this->crud->addField([// Select  | 
                                                        |
| 54 | 54 | 'label' => 'From Status',  | 
                                                        
| 55 | 55 | 'type' => 'select',  | 
                                                        
| 56 | 56 | 'name' => 'from_job_poster_status_id', // the db column for the foreign key  | 
                                                        
@@ -60,7 +60,7 @@ discard block  | 
                                                    ||
| 60 | 60 | 'attributes' => ['disabled' => 'disabled']  | 
                                                        
| 61 | 61 | ]);  | 
                                                        
| 62 | 62 | |
| 63 | - $this->crud->addField([ // Select  | 
                                                        |
| 63 | + $this->crud->addField([// Select  | 
                                                        |
| 64 | 64 | 'label' => 'To Status',  | 
                                                        
| 65 | 65 | 'type' => 'select',  | 
                                                        
| 66 | 66 | 'name' => 'to_job_poster_status_id', // the db column for the foreign key  | 
                                                        
@@ -47,7 +47,7 @@  | 
                                                    ||
| 47 | 47 |                  $ids = explode(',', $ids); | 
                                                        
| 48 | 48 |                  if ($ids) { | 
                                                        
| 49 | 49 |                      array_map(function ($v) { | 
                                                        
| 50 | - return (int) $v;  | 
                                                        |
| 50 | + return (int)$v;  | 
                                                        |
| 51 | 51 | }, $ids);  | 
                                                        
| 52 | 52 |                      $users = User::whereIn('id', $ids)->with(['applicant', 'manager', 'hr_advisor'])->get(); | 
                                                        
| 53 | 53 | }  | 
                                                        
@@ -12,7 +12,7 @@  | 
                                                    ||
| 12 | 12 | class ApplicationValidator  | 
                                                        
| 13 | 13 |  { | 
                                                        
| 14 | 14 | |
| 15 | - public $backendRules = [  | 
                                                        |
| 15 | + public $backendRules = [  | 
                                                        |
| 16 | 16 | 'job_poster_id' => 'required',  | 
                                                        
| 17 | 17 | 'application_status_id' => 'required',  | 
                                                        
| 18 | 18 | 'applicant_id' => 'required',  | 
                                                        
@@ -830,7 +830,7 @@ discard block  | 
                                                    ||
| 830 | 830 |          ->name('jobs.setJobStatus'); | 
                                                        
| 831 | 831 |      Route::resource('jobs', 'Api\JobController')->only([ | 
                                                        
| 832 | 832 | 'show', 'store', 'update', 'index'  | 
                                                        
| 833 | - ])->names([ // Specify custom names because default names collied with existing routes.  | 
                                                        |
| 833 | + ])->names([// Specify custom names because default names collied with existing routes.  | 
                                                        |
| 834 | 834 | 'show' => 'jobs.show',  | 
                                                        
| 835 | 835 | 'store' => 'jobs.store',  | 
                                                        
| 836 | 836 | 'update' => 'jobs.update',  | 
                                                        
@@ -843,7 +843,7 @@ discard block  | 
                                                    ||
| 843 | 843 | |
| 844 | 844 |      Route::resource('managers', 'Api\ManagerController')->only([ | 
                                                        
| 845 | 845 | 'show', 'update'  | 
                                                        
| 846 | - ])->names([ // Specify custom names because default names collied with existing routes.  | 
                                                        |
| 846 | + ])->names([// Specify custom names because default names collied with existing routes.  | 
                                                        |
| 847 | 847 | 'show' => 'managers.show',  | 
                                                        
| 848 | 848 | 'update' => 'managers.update'  | 
                                                        
| 849 | 849 | ]);  | 
                                                        
@@ -773,8 +773,8 @@  | 
                                                    ||
| 773 | 773 |                      ->middleware('can:downloadApplicants,jobPoster') | 
                                                        
| 774 | 774 |                      ->name('admin.jobs.download.applicants'); | 
                                                        
| 775 | 775 | |
| 776 | - /* View Applicant Profile */  | 
                                                        |
| 777 | -                 Route::get('applicants/{applicant}', 'ApplicantProfileController@profile') | 
                                                        |
| 776 | + /* View Applicant Profile */  | 
                                                        |
| 777 | +                    Route::get('applicants/{applicant}', 'ApplicantProfileController@profile') | 
                                                        |
| 778 | 778 |                      ->middleware('can:view,applicant') | 
                                                        
| 779 | 779 |                      ->name('admin.applicants.profile'); | 
                                                        
| 780 | 780 | }  | 
                                                        
@@ -947,7 +947,7 @@  | 
                                                    ||
| 947 | 947 | * @param \App\Models\JobPoster $jobPoster Incoming Job Poster object.  | 
                                                        
| 948 | 948 | * @param string $application_step Current step in application.  | 
                                                        
| 949 | 949 | * @return array  | 
                                                        
| 950 | - */  | 
                                                        |
| 950 | + */  | 
                                                        |
| 951 | 951 | public function customBreadcrumbs(JobPoster $jobPoster, string $application_step)  | 
                                                        
| 952 | 952 |      { | 
                                                        
| 953 | 953 |          $step_lang = Lang::get('applicant/application_template.tracker_label'); | 
                                                        
@@ -32,7 +32,7 @@  | 
                                                    ||
| 32 | 32 | * Skill declaration validator constructor.  | 
                                                        
| 33 | 33 | * @param SkillDeclaration $skillDeclaration The skill declaration input data.  | 
                                                        
| 34 | 34 | * @return ValidationValidator  | 
                                                        
| 35 | - */  | 
                                                        |
| 35 | + */  | 
                                                        |
| 36 | 36 | public function validator(SkillDeclaration $skillDeclaration)  | 
                                                        
| 37 | 37 |      { | 
                                                        
| 38 | 38 | $uniqueSkillRule = new UniqueSkillDeclarationRule($skillDeclaration->skillable->skill_declarations, $skillDeclaration->id);  | 
                                                        
@@ -24,7 +24,6 @@  | 
                                                    ||
| 24 | 24 | *  | 
                                                        
| 25 | 25 | * @param \Illuminate\Http\Request $request Incoming Request.  | 
                                                        
| 26 | 26 | * @param \App\Models\JobPoster $jobPoster Incoming JobPoster object.  | 
                                                        
| 27 | -  | 
                                                        |
| 28 | 27 | * @return \Illuminate\Http\Response  | 
                                                        
| 29 | 28 | */  | 
                                                        
| 30 | 29 | public function show(Request $request, JobPoster $jobPoster)  |